- Description
- Location: Seat of the Msunduzi Local Municipality and the uMgungundlovu District Municipality, capital of the KwaZulu-Natal province.
- Founded: 1838, and named after the Boer leaders Piet Retief and Gerrit Maritz. Its Zulu name is uMgungundlovu, meaning ‘Place of the elephant’.
- Name: Colloquially known as the City of Flowers after its azaleas and roses. The city is also home to one of South Africa’s National Botanical Gardens, as well as the butterfly conservation centre Butterflies for Africa.
- Economy: Growing business and industrial centre. Manufactures mostly furniture, foot ware, aluminium ware. Also produces timber and dairy products.
